What Makes an Underrated Burger Stand Out?
An underrated Denver burger isn’t just a slab of meat between two buns; it’s a carefully curated experience. Often, these establishments prioritize locally sourced beef, ground in-house for superior freshness and flavor. The bun is never an afterthought, usually toasted to perfection, providing the ideal structural integrity and textural contrast. Toppings, while sometimes classic, often feature house-made sauces, unique cheese selections, or expertly caramelized onions that elevate the entire ensemble. The cooking technique itself is paramount, whether it’s a crispy-edged smash burger on a scorching hot flat-top or a juicy, char-grilled masterpiece, each method designed to maximize flavor and texture.
